8 / 22 page ![]() 8 ATSAM2133B 2694A–DRMSD–05/03 100-ball LFBGA Package Table 3. Pin by Function - 100-ball LFBGA Package Pin Name Pin Number Type Function GND A3, A9, C7, D5, D10, E1, F7, G4, G5, J5, J8 PWR Power ground - all GND pins should be returned to digital ground VC2 B6, C5, C6, E2, H6 PWR Core power +2.5V ±10%. All V C2 pins should be returned to +2.5V. If the built-in power switch is used for minimum power-down consumption, then all these pins should be connected to PWROUT, the output of the built-in power switch. VC3 C3, D8, G2, G10, H4, H7 PWR Periphery power 2.25V to 3.7V. All V C3 pins should be returned to nominal +3.3V. VC3 should be lower than V C2. PWRIN A8 PWR Power switch input, 2.25V to 2.95V. Even if the power switch feature is not used, this pin must be connected to nominal 2.5V PWROUT B7 PWR Power switch output. Use this pin to supply 2.5V core power by connecting it to all V C2 pins. D0 - D7 E4, D1, E3, F4, F3, F5, F2, F1 I/O 8-bit data bus to host processor. Information on these pins is parallel MIDI (MPU-401 type applications). CS C1 IN Chip select from host, active low. WR C2 IN Write from host, active low. RD D2 IN Read from host, active low. A0 D3 IN Selects MPU-401 internal registers: 0: data registers (read/write) 1: status register (read) control register (write) IRQ B1 TSOUT Tri-state output pin, active high. RESET H3 IN Master reset input, active low. X1, X2 D6, A7 - Crystal connection. Crystal frequency should be Fs * 256 (typ 11.2896 MHz). Crystal frequency is internally multiplied by 4 to provide the IC master clock. An external 11.2896 MHz clock can also be used on X1 (2.5V PP max through 47 pF capacitor). X2 cannot be used to drive external ICs; use CKOUT instead. CKOUT E5 OUT Buffered X2 output. Can be used to drive external DAC master clock (256 * Fs) DABD0 - 1 A4, B4 OUT Two stereo serial audio data output (4 audio channels). Each output holds 64 bits (2 x 32) of serial data per frame. Audio data precise up to 20 bits. DABD0 can hold additional control data (mute, A/D gain, D/A gain, etc.) CLBD C4 OUT Audio data bit clock, provides timing to DABD0 - 1, DAAD. WSBD B3 OUT Audio data word select. The timing of WSBD can be selected to be I2S or Japanese compatible. DAAD A2 IN Stereo serial audio data input. P0 - P3 G1, G3, H2, H1 I/O General-purpose programmable I/O pins. DBCLK A5 IN Debug clock. Should be connected to V C3 under normal operation. If DBCLK is found low just after RESET, then the internal ROM debugger/flash programmer is started DBDATA D4 I/O Debug data. Allows serial communication for debug/flash programming DBACK B5 OUT Debug ack. Toggled each time a bit is received/sent on DBDATA MIDI IN A1 IN MIDI IN input MIDI OUT B2 OUT MIDI OUT output |
